TNS Media Intelligence, the media tracking firm that provides the “Top 50 Advertisers by Media Value” each month, has acquired Cymfony, which has experience measuring traditional and social media research and analysis. Both parties agree the services will be complimentary, “When you start to combine consumer sentiment with ad spend, you’re getting a much clearer perspective,” said Steven Fredericks, president and CEO of TNS Media Intelligence. He said advertisers will be better advised on where to place, or shift, their dollars on campaigns.
“This is a validation of the social media space; it also says a lot of the overall space: Social media is not going away and has a huge impact,” said Andrew Bernstein, CEO at Cymfony.
